New Delhi : The Union Culture Ministry has selected four cities in Maharashtra for ‘Yoga is an Indian Heritage’ campaign that will be held on the occasion of International Yoga Day on June 21.
Four cites are – Aga Khan Palace, Pune, Kanheri Caves, Mumbai, Ellora Caves, Aurangabad, and Old High Court Building, Nagpur.
These four monuments are centrally protected monuments of national importance.
